The grapes were gently hand-picked before dawn to ensure cold fruit arrives at the winery, where it was whole-cluster pressed. We cold settled and racked the juice before fermenting it in French oak barrels. After fermentation the wine sat on the lees and was stirred every two weeks. The wine underwent full malolactic fermentation to soften the higher acids. Aged over 16 months then minimally fined and filtered just prior to bottling.

Tasting notes
Lemon cheesecake, floral, and spiced apple cider aromas escape from the glass at the first swirl. Higher tones of tropical fruit and citrus rinds become prominent as the wine opens up. The wine is bright and refreshing on the entry, yet the lush texture and minerality on the finish is the hallmark of this wine. Cantaloupe and green apple flavors give way to a crisp, clean finish of pear and toasted pine nuts.Winemaker Brandon Lapides
